Greenpage Source Page
Tuesday, October 8, 2024
Flagship beauty store facade stands out with LED fins Flagship store facade stands out with LED fins
Flagship beauty store facade stands out with LED fins Flagship store facade stands out with LED fins
Newer Post
Older Post
Home